The Supreme Court ruled last week that a lower court's order "requires the government to 'facilitate' Abrego Garcia's release from custody in El Salvador and to ensure that his case is handled as it would have been had he not been improperly sent to El Salvador."

The "Outnumbered" panel discussed the mainstream media's sympathy with illegal immigrants. (Fox News)
Abrego Garcia was granted temporary protection status in the U.S. by a court in 2019 from being removed to El Salvador, after it determined he would face criminal prosecution from gangs if he were removed to his home country.
The Trump administration later admitted his deportation was an "administrative error."
The panel added that the White House has said Abrego Garcia is a member of MS-13, whom the Trump administration designated as a terrorist organization earlier this year.
"Why are people willing to fight to get criminals back into this country?" panel member Harris Faulkner asked. "We can’t even handle all the ones who are already on our streets. Why do you want more of them? And two courts found this guy was a terrorist — I mean, a gang member tied to domestic terrorism. That’s what they are. They are gangs. So you want to bring him back into the country, and then you want this Sen. Chris Van Hollen of Maryland to go there to what, AOC this, stand by the window, cheer for him or whatever?"
Fox News contributor Guy Benson said regardless of whether Abrego Garcia has gang ties, he does not have the right to return to the U.S. because of his illegal status.
